Even at a tender age, Trumper, also known as "Aces," proved that poker has a significance in his life because it was the reason behind his expulsion from school when he was a kid.
After finishing his Math exams, little Simon played poker dices on his chair and before he knew it, his parents found another school for him where he could "outgrow" his addiction to poker.
It could be said that Trumper had a natural inclination to the game, but unlike other known poker players today, he did not make a career out of poker early on in his life.

Born in Kensington, May 31st 1963, Simon Trumper was a late bloomer as far as poker players go; he didn’t start playing poker until 1995.
Trumper started off playing in small, low-limit games; before long, he found himself winning more and more, and as his bankroll grew, he progressed to bigger tournaments with higher limits.
While Trumper hasn’t made a huge impact at the World Series of Poker (he has yet to win a bracelet at the prestigious American event), he has definitely left his mark on the European scene.
